摘要
Nano-sized alpha-Al2O3 particles with an average size of 30-40 nm were prepared successfully from supersaturated sodium aluminate solution with liquid-attached aluminum hydroxide and nano-sized alpha-Al2O3 as seeds as well as a reasonable amount of PEG20000 as surfactant. The powders were characterized by differential scanning calorimetry (DSC)/thermogravimetry (TG), scanning electron microscopy (SEM) and X-ray diffraction (XRD). It was found that liquid-attached AI(OH)3 and nano-sized a-At,03 seeds can accelerate the precipitating process and reduce the alpha-Al2O3 particles size.
